ARTEMIS

(Gerard de Nerval)

The thirteenth returns ... It is still the first
and it is always the only ... or it is the sole moment.
Because you are a queen, 0 you, are you the first or last?
Are you a king, you alone, or the last lover?

Love, then, whoever has loved you from cradle to coffin.
Whomever I have loved still loves me tenderly.
It is death-my mistress—O pleasure, O torment.
The rose that she holds is the rose hollyhock.

Saint Napolitaine with hands full of fire,
a rose with a violet heart, flower of holy Gudule.
Have you found your cross in the desert of the sky?

White roses, fall! You insult our gods.
Fall, white phantoms, from your burning sky!
— the saint from the abyss is more holy to my eyes.
